Can p7zip (typically what's the 7z executable in Linux distributions) correctly
extract the files?
I'd suspect that first at least partially because Ark uses that for 7z files,
although the extraction may be done with the K7zip implementation.

Do the affected files contain special characters? Sometimes it's sneaky like
_﹘—- being 4 different characters with the middle 2 being "Unicode", and the
7-Zip project is quite Windows-specific, embracing UTF-16 and locale madness,
making it possible that an archive made on one system isn't handled well on
another:
